The Power of Hashtags: Unlocking Connections and Engagement

Hashtags, with their unique ability to categorize and organize content, have revolutionized the way we interact on social media. They serve as a powerful tool for users to express their interests, join conversations, and discover like-minded individuals. From trending topics to niche communities, hashtags provide a gateway to a vast digital ecosystem, making it easier for users to navigate and explore.

The use of hashtags has become a strategic element in content creation and marketing, enabling brands and influencers to reach their target audiences effectively. By understanding the popularity and relevance of hashtags, content creators can enhance the visibility and reach of their posts, ultimately driving engagement and fostering meaningful connections.

The Impact of Hashtags on Content and Engagement

Hashtags have a profound impact on the success and reach of social media content. By strategically incorporating relevant and popular hashtags, content creators can achieve several key benefits:

Increased Visibility and Reach

Popular hashtags act as a powerful tool to increase the visibility of posts. When users search for a specific hashtag, they are directed to a feed of relevant content, including your post, thereby expanding its reach to a wider audience.

Improved Engagement and Interactions

Hashtags encourage user engagement by fostering conversations and interactions. Users who engage with a hashtag are more likely to comment, like, and share posts, creating a vibrant and active community around that particular topic.

Building Communities and Connections

Hashtags serve as a bridge between users, helping to build and strengthen communities. By using specific hashtags, content creators can attract like-minded individuals, foster meaningful connections, and create a sense of belonging within their niche.

Keeping up with popular hashtags allows content creators to stay relevant and timely. By incorporating trending hashtags, creators can align their content with current events, trends, and user interests, ensuring their posts are seen and engaged with.

What is the ideal number of hashtags to use in a post?

+

The ideal number of hashtags varies depending on the platform and your content strategy. On Instagram, using 5-10 hashtags is common, while Twitter often allows for longer hashtag lists. Experiment with different quantities and analyze your post’s performance to find the sweet spot for your audience and platform.

How can I track the performance of my hashtags?

+

Most social media platforms provide analytics tools that allow you to track the performance of your posts and hashtags. These insights can help you understand which hashtags are driving engagement and reach. Additionally, you can use third-party tools like Sprout Social or Hootsuite to analyze and monitor hashtag performance across multiple platforms.

Are there any guidelines for creating effective hashtags?

+

When creating hashtags, keep them concise, relevant, and easy to remember. Avoid using overly long or complex phrases, as they may be difficult for users to type and remember. Make sure your hashtags accurately represent your content and align with your brand or message. Also, consider the tone and context of your hashtags to ensure they resonate with your target audience.

Can I use the same hashtags across different social media platforms?

+

While you can use the same hashtags across platforms, it’s important to consider the nuances and preferences of each platform. For example, Instagram users often favor visual-centric hashtags, while Twitter users tend to engage with more topical and news-related hashtags. Adapt your hashtag strategy to align with the unique characteristics of each platform for optimal results.
